factanal.fit.principal(cmat, factors, p = ncol(cmat), start =NULL,iter.max =10, unique.tol =1e-04)
Arguments
cmat: provided correlation matrix
factors: number of factors
p: number of observations
start: vector of start values
iter.max: maximum number of iteration used to calculate the common factor
unique.tol: the tolerance for a deviation of the maximum (in each row, without the diag) value of the given correlation matrix to the new calculated value
Returns
loadings: A matrix of loadings, one column for each factor. The factors are ordered in decreasing order of sums of squares of loadings.
uniquness: uniquness
correlation: correlation matrix
criteria: The results of the optimization: the value of the negativ log-likelihood and information of the iterations used.
factors: the factors
dof: degrees of freedom
method: "principal"
